I feel like there must be a way to do this (and sorry if this is a repeat post, my search didn't result in answers), but I can't figure it out. I've done some non click-based recording, am working to assemble parts, and it would be supremely useful to be able to set the grid to the length of one of my items (or the current selection, doesn't matter).

are the "set project tempo / create time signature from time selection" options what you need? - (right click in the timeline)
